Understanding Pornography Addiction
Before addressing steps for recovery, it’s essential to understand pornography addiction. Similar to other behavioral addictions, pornography addiction is characterized by compulsive behaviors that override personal and social responsibilities. Individuals with this addiction may feel unable to stop viewing explicit content, even if it negatively impacts their relationships, work, or overall well-being.
Recognizing pornography addiction as a legitimate mental health struggle, rather than a moral failing, is the first step toward meaningful recovery. With this understanding, the path to pornography addiction recovery becomes clearer.
Steps to Take After Discovering Pornography Addiction
1. Process Your Own Feelings
Discovering someone’s addiction can be emotionally taxing for you, too. It’s important to acknowledge your own feelings and give yourself time to process the situation. Whether you’re feeling anger, betrayal, sadness, or confusion, these emotions are valid.
Consider journaling, connecting with a trusted friend, or seeking professional support to process your emotions. Addressing your feelings in a healthy way ensures you’ll be better equipped to support your loved one on their recovery journey.
2. Approach the Topic with Compassion
Confronting a loved one about pornography addiction can be a delicate conversation. It’s important to lead with empathy rather than judgment. Express that your primary concern is their well-being and that you’re here to support them.
For example, instead of saying, “How could you do this to me?” consider framing it as, “I’ve noticed behavior that concerns me, and I want to understand how I can help.”
A compassionate approach opens the door for honest communication and helps reduce feelings of shame, which is often a significant barrier to pornography addiction recovery.
3. Encourage Professional Help
Pornography addiction is complex, and professional support is often essential for effective recovery. Therapists and counselors who specialize in pornography addiction treatment can provide the tools and strategies needed to break the cycle of addiction.

For some individuals, group therapy or support groups such as Sex Addicts Anonymous can also provide a nonjudgmental space to share experiences and rebuild self-esteem.
4. Set Boundaries
While it’s important to be supportive, setting clear boundaries is equally crucial. Healthy boundaries help both you and your loved one understand what is acceptable behavior and what is not. This may include open communication about triggers, transparency about device usage, or agreeing on a plan to tackle the addiction head-on.
Boundaries shouldn’t be punitive but rather a means to create mutual trust and a foundation for accountability. For example, you might agree to use shared device monitoring apps or create an environment that discourages isolation.
5. Build a Support Network
Pornography addiction doesn’t just affect the individual struggling with it—it impacts families, friends, and relationships. Forming a strong support network is crucial for everyone involved.
For loved ones, networks like peer support groups or family therapy can provide guidance, tools, and emotional relief. They’ll also help establish strategies to handle challenges without allowing resentment or frustration to fester.
6. Be Patient with the Process
Recovery from pornography addiction is not an overnight process. It involves time, effort, and setbacks along the way. Understand that healing and change will take time for both you and your loved one. Set realistic expectations and celebrate small wins on the road to recovery.
Above all, maintain hope. With consistent effort and the right resources, many people struggling with pornography addiction successfully regain control of their lives and repair their relationships.
